METHODS AND SYSTEMS FOR A GAS INFUSION BEVERAGE DISTRIBUTION ASSEMBLY
20230108596 · 2023-04-06 ·

A system and method for providing a consumable liquid infused with gas from a liquid processor. The liquid processor may comprise a gas input port configured to receive the compressed gas. The liquid processor may further comprise a liquid input port configured to receive a consumable liquid. The liquid processor may further comprise a venturi injector configured to combine the compressed gas with the consumable liquid. The liquid processor may further comprise a static inline mixer including a plurality of mixing elements and configured to mix the combined consumable liquid with the compressed gas to form the consumable liquid infused with a compressed gas. The liquid processor may further comprise an output port configured to provide the consumable liquid infused with a compressed gas.

Frozen Beverage Dispensing Machines with Multi-Flavor Valves
20170320719 · 2017-11-09 · ·

A beverage machine includes a valve that receives a base fluid and dispenses a mixed beverage comprising the base fluid and an additive fluid. The valve has a bore through which the base fluid flows, and the bore has a perimetral surface that defines a plurality of ports through which the additive fluid is injected to thereby mix with the base fluid. An injector is coupled to the valve and configured to radially inject the additive fluid into the base fluid through the plurality of ports as the base fluid flows through the bore such that the additive fluid mixes into the base fluid to form the mixed beverage.

Inserts and nozzle assemblies for beverage dispensers

An insert for use with a beverage dispenser includes a diffuser having an upstream end configured to receive the first base fluid, a downstream end with an outlet configured to dispense the first base fluid, and a center bore extending between the upstream end and the downstream end along an axis. A stem is disposed in the center bore of the diffuser and has a first end configured to receive a second base fluid and an opposite second end with an outlet configured to dispense the second base fluid. The outlet of the diffuser is upstream from the outlet of the stem such that the first base fluid dispensed from the outlet of the diffuser mixes with an additive fluid before the second base fluid dispensed from the outlet of the stem mixes with the additive fluid.

NITROGEN INFUSING APPARATUS
20230312324 · 2023-10-05 ·

An apparatus for nitrogenizing a beverage utilizing a container having a chamber with a plurality of baffles. The container also includes a gas controller regulator in the form of a collapsible orifice at the base of the container. An agitator in the form of a rotating shaft creates a shear on the beverage during delivery of a stream of nitrogen gas into the container.

Beverage dispensing nozzle with in-nozzle mixing

A beverage dispensing system includes a nozzle assembly and a valve system, the nozzle assembly including a nozzle body having a diffuser chamber, a mixing chamber, and one or more cooling channels formed therein, a diffuser disposed within the diffuser chamber, and a manifold having one or more cooling channels formed therein and being configured to receive a flow of a base fluid and a flow of a concentrate for mixing of the base fluid and the concentrate in the mixing chamber to provide a beverage, and the valve system including one or more valves for regulating respective flow rates of each of the base fluid and the concentrate to substantially achieve a target mix ratio of the base fluid to concentrate within the mixing chamber.
